Target Outcomes for Mississippi Fellowship Recipients
The Fellowship Promoting Advancements In Science And Technology For Emerging Professionals is designed to drive innovation and progress in Mississippi by supporting emerging professionals in their research and development endeavors. Given the state's unique challenges and opportunities, the fellowship prioritizes outcomes that address critical needs and leverage the state's strengths.
Advancing Research Capacity in Key Sectors
Mississippi is home to a growing number of research institutions and organizations, including the Mississippi State University's Research and Technology Corporation, which is a key partner in advancing the state's research capacity. The fellowship aims to build on this momentum by supporting projects that drive innovation in areas such as advanced manufacturing, biosciences, and information technology. By focusing on these sectors, the fellowship is likely to have a significant impact on the state's economy, particularly in rural areas where economic development opportunities are limited. For instance, the Mississippi Delta region, with its rich cultural heritage and natural resources, presents opportunities for research and development in areas like sustainable agriculture and eco-tourism. Enhancing STEM Education and Workforce Development
Mississippi faces challenges in STEM education, with the state ranking below the national average in terms of high school students' proficiency in math and science. The fellowship seeks to address this issue by supporting projects that enhance STEM education and workforce development, particularly in underserved communities. By doing so, the fellowship aims to create a more robust pipeline of talent for the state's growing industries, including the technology sector, which is a key driver of economic growth in the state. Fostering Innovation and Entrepreneurship
The fellowship also prioritizes outcomes that foster innovation and entrepreneurship in Mississippi. The state has a growing entrepreneurial ecosystem, with organizations like the Mississippi Technology Alliance playing a key role in supporting startups and small businesses. By supporting emerging professionals who are working on innovative projects, the fellowship aims to drive the creation of new products, services, and businesses that can compete in the global marketplace.
